薄荷脱毒苗的离体培养及快速繁殖

摘    要:探讨薄荷(Mentha hoplocalyx Briq)离体培养过程,为优良品种的快速繁殖奠定基础。以薄荷脱毒苗带茎节为外植体,采用MS基本培养基,附加不同激素进行实验。培养基中附加激素6-BA有利芽的发生;适宜的6-BA浓度为1mg/L,出芽率高且出芽数量多;对愈伤组织的增殖以添加2,4-D0.5mg/L、NAA0.5mg/L和6-BAl.Omg/L为最佳。通过薄荷离体培养的研究,获得了较高的植株再生频率,建立有效的组织培养再生体系。

In Vitro Culture and Rapid Propagation of Non-virs Plant of Menthe

Abstract:To study the in vitro culture of Mentha haplocalyx(Briq.)so as to lay a foundation for the rapid propagation of its improved breeds. The explants used for culture were stem segments with node from Mentha. The media were Ms basal media containing different plant hormones. The media containing 6-BA were effective to induce shoot formation. Optimal BA concentration for shoot and growth was 1mg/L; The best medium with the addition of 2,4-D(0.5mg/L),NAA(0.5mg/L),and 6-BA(1.0mg/L) gave optimal cell. An effective plant regeneration system has been established for Mentha haplicalyx on the basis of factors affecting the culture in vitro.
